Central Railway is set to enhance the daily commute for Mumbaikars by launching 12 additional air-conditioned (AC) local train services on the Main Line. This significant upgrade is scheduled to commence on Monday, June 29, 2026, responding to passenger demand for more comfortable travel options, especially during the summer months.
These 12 new services will replace existing non-AC local trains, bolstering the total count of AC local services operated by Central Railway to 120. This includes 92 services on the Main Line and 28 on the Harbour Line, further improving connectivity and passenger experience across the Mumbai suburban network.
The AC services will operate with AC rakes from Monday to Saturday. On Sundays and designated holidays, these trains will run with non-AC rakes. This adjustment ensures service availability while maintaining operational flexibility. The overall number of suburban services on weekdays across Mumbai Division will remain consistent at 1820.
